A biochemical pathway diagram illustrating the metabolism of Azathioprine. The diagram shows Azathioprine converting to 6-MP, which then follows different enzymatic routes and metabolites including 6-MeMP, 6-TU, TIMP, and 6-TGN, with key enzymes such as TPMT, XO, and HGPRT involved. The pathway also notes processes like inhibition of purine synthesis and incorporation into DNA.*
